揭秘:如何精准评估运维工作量?5个关键指标助你事半功倍!

运维工作量评估的重要性

准确评估运维工作量对于提高IT运维效率和资源分配至关重要。合理的运维工作量评估能够帮助团队更好地规划任务、分配资源,并确保项目按时交付。然而,由于运维工作的复杂性和多变性,许多企业在评估运维工作量时仍面临诸多挑战。本文将深入探讨如何精准评估运维工作量,并介绍5个关键指标,帮助您更好地管理运维工作。

 

运维工作量评估的5个关键指标

要精准评估运维工作量,我们需要关注以下5个关键指标:

1. 系统复杂度:系统的架构、规模和技术栈直接影响运维工作的难度和工作量。评估系统复杂度时,需要考虑服务器数量、应用程序类型、数据库规模等因素。例如,一个包含多个微服务、使用多种编程语言和数据库的分布式系统,其运维工作量显然高于一个简单的单体应用。

2. 变更频率:系统更新和配置变更的频率直接影响运维工作量。频繁的版本发布、配置修改和补丁安装都会增加运维工作。建议使用版本控制系统和自动化部署工具来管理变更,减少人工操作带来的工作量和错误。

3. 监控和告警处理:有效的监控系统能够及时发现和解决问题,但同时也会产生大量的告警信息需要处理。评估这部分工作量时,需要考虑监控覆盖范围、告警规则的精确度以及平均每天需要处理的告警数量。

4. 日常维护任务:包括备份、日志分析、性能优化等routine工作。这些任务虽然是例行性质,但仍然占用大量时间。评估时需要列出所有日常维护任务,估算每项任务的频率和所需时间。

5. 突发事件处理:运维工作中难免会遇到突发故障或安全事件。虽然这类工作难以精确预估,但可以根据历史数据和经验值进行合理预算。建议设立应急响应机制,并定期进行演练,以提高团队应对突发事件的能力。

 

运维工作量评估的实践方法

在掌握了关键指标后,我们可以采用以下方法来进行更精准的运维工作量评估:

1. 建立工作分解结构(WBS):将运维工作细分为具体的任务和子任务,有助于更准确地估算每项工作的时间和资源需求。可以使用项目管理工具如ONES研发管理平台来创建和管理WBS,实现更高效的任务分配和进度跟踪。

2. 利用历史数据:收集并分析过去的运维工作记录,包括任务完成时间、资源消耗等信息。这些数据可以帮助我们更准确地预估未来类似工作的工作量。

3. 应用PERT技术:PERT(项目评审技术)可以帮助我们更科学地估算工作量。对每项任务估算最乐观、最可能和最悲观三种情况的工作量,然后使用公式:(最乐观 + 4 * 最可能 + 最悲观) / 6 来计算期望工作量。

4. 引入自动化工具:使用自动化工具可以大大减少人工操作,提高工作效率。例如,使用配置管理工具如Ansible或Puppet可以自动化部署和配置过程,减少人工干预。

5. 定期评估和调整:运维环境是动态变化的,因此工作量评估也需要定期更新。建议每季度或每半年对运维工作量进行一次全面评估,及时调整资源分配和工作计划。

 

运维工作量评估的常见误区

在进行运维工作量评估时,我们还需要注意避免以下常见误区:

1. 忽视隐性工作:很多运维工作是”看不见”的,如文档编写、知识分享、技能学习等。这些工作虽然不直接产生可见的输出,但对于团队的长期效率至关重要。在评估时应将这些隐性工作纳入考虑范围。

2. 低估沟通成本:运维工作往往涉及多个团队和部门的协作。有效的沟通和协调需要大量时间和精力。在评估工作量时,应充分考虑沟通成本,包括会议、邮件往来、文档交接等。

3. 过度依赖个人经验:虽然经验很重要,但仅凭个人直觉进行评估容易产生偏差。建议结合数据分析、团队讨论等方式,以获得更客观的评估结果。

4. 忽视技术债务:长期积累的技术债务会逐渐增加运维工作量。在评估时应考虑系统的技术债务状况,并制定相应的改进计划。

5. 没有考虑学习曲线:引入新技术或工具时,团队成员需要时间学习和适应。在评估工作量时,应为学习和培训预留足够的时间和资源。

 

总结与展望

精准评估运维工作量是一项挑战,但通过关注系统复杂度、变更频率、监控告警处理、日常维护任务和突发事件处理这五个关键指标,并采用科学的评估方法,我们可以显著提高评估的准确性。准确的运维工作量评估不仅有助于优化资源分配,还能提高团队工作效率,降低运维成本。

随着云计算、人工智能等技术的发展,运维工作的内容和形式也在不断演变。未来,我们需要持续关注新技术带来的机遇和挑战,不断优化运维工作量评估方法。只有这样,才能在瞬息万变的IT环境中保持竞争优势,为企业创造更大的价值。

运维工作量